User: Lorielle from Fort Campbell, KY    User Rating:
This recipe is one of my favorites. I make it alot. It's extremely easy and extremely mouth-watering!!! The only thing annoying about the recipe is pounding the pork chops down to size, so be real careful when you buy your chops. I made the mistake of buying the thick cut ones before.......lets just say it took alot longer than it should have. But I have it down pat now. I would suggest that if your making for more than 2-3 people you should use two pans so everything stays hot and juicy!! Also, I would suggest that you let them simmer on low/warm for about 10 minutes after what the recipe says, it helps with the sweet jalapeno sauce. Just my tips that I noticed. Everybody likes different things. But I would definitely try it if I were you!!
